Result of ServiceThe Consultant will contribute to the efficient mapping of the ASYCUDA NCTS 6 ASYCUDA to the EU Common Transit Convention requirements Work LocationHome based Expected duration01.09.25 - 31.12.25 Duties and ResponsibilitiesUnder the general supervision of UNCTAD ASYCUDA Regional Coordinator for Eastern Europe and Central Asia the consultant will undertake following duties: - Providing functional advise and assistance in finalization of NCTS Version 6 . - Ensuring that the MCS NCTS system meets operational and regulatory requirements of the EU NCTS - Verifying NCTS Version 6 for the EU Common Transit Convention compliance - Functional advise in preparation of conformance tests - Provide regular inputs to project status reports and updates to key stakeholders Qualifications/special skillsA first university degree, Bachelor, degree in Customs, business administration, law, economics or related area is required. 2 years of work experience in dealing with IT system's analysis, implementation and management experience in implementation of Customs IT systems and modules is required. Work experience of work in customs administration, revenue authority or trade support institution is required. Combination of IT and Customs experience would be a strong advantage. Work experience of dealing with NCTS solutions and/or ICT applications for e-Commerce operators is desirable. Work experience of involvement in UN, EU or other international projects is desirable. LanguagesFluency written and oral in English is required. Additional InformationNot available.
